Оптимізація продуктивності: тестування та виправлення помилок для швидкості.
Вступ до оптимізації продуктивності у веб-розробці
У світі веб-розробки важливо, щоб ваш вебсайт працював на піку продуктивності. Оптимізація продуктивності не тільки стосується прискорення вашого вебсайту; це також про покращення користувацького досвіду, підвищення рейтингів у пошукових системах та максимізацію ефективності веб-ресурсів. Цей посібник розгляне основні методи тестування та відлагодження, спрямовані на оптимізацію швидкості вебсайтів, побудованих з використанням HTML, PHP, CSS, JS та WordPress.
Розуміння Основ Продуктивності Вебсайтів
Перш ніж перейти до технік оптимізації, важливо зрозуміти, що робить вебсайт ефективним. Продуктивність можна вимірювати декількома способами, але найпоширенішими метриками є час завантаження, час першого байта (TTFB) та час відображення. Інструменти, такі як Google PageSpeed Insights та WebPageTest, можуть допомогти виявити проблемні моменти в продуктивності.
Техніки для Оптимізації Продуктивності Вебсайтів
Оптимізація продуктивності вашого вебсайту включає різноманітні техніки, які спрямовані на різні аспекти веб-розробки.
Мінімізація HTTP-запитів
Один із перших кроків у покращенні продуктивності вашого вебсайту – це зменшення кількості HTTP-запитів. Це можна досягти шляхом об’єднання файлів CSS та JavaScript, використання спрайтів CSS та оптимізації зображень.
Використання Кешування Браузера
Кешування браузера зберігає файли ресурсів вебсторінки на локальному комп’ютері, коли користувач відвідує вебсторінку, це означає, що браузер не повинен повністю перезавантажувати сторінку під час повернення користувача.
Оптимізація CSS та JavaScript
Впевненість у тому, що ваші CSS та JavaScript написані ефективно, може значно вплинути на швидкість вашого сайту. Техніки включають мінімізацію та стиснення файлів, видалення не використовуваного коду і оптимізацію виконання CSS та JavaScript.
Ефективне Використання PHP та WordPress
Для PHP та WordPress використання кешування опкоду, оптимізація запитів до бази даних та використання ефективних плагінів для WordPress може радикально покращити продуктивність. Регулярний огляд та оптимізація коду вашої теми та плагінів WordPress є важливим для збереження швидкості.
Тестування та Відлагодження для Швидкості
Після впровадження оптимізації продуктивності важливо протестувати та відлагодити ваш вебсайт для вимірювання впливу ваших змін.
Використання Інструментів для Тестування Продуктивності
Різноманітні інструменти можуть допомогти вам оцінити продуктивність вашого вебсайту. Google PageSpeed Insights, GTmetrix та Lighthouse надають комплексний аналіз швидкості вашого вебсайту та пропонують рекомендації для покращення.
Відлагодження Проблем Продуктивності
При виникненні проблем продуктивності важливо швидко відлагодити їх. Інструменти розробника браузера, такі як у Chrome та Firefox, дозволяють в режимі реального часу контролювати продуктивність вашого вебсайту та визначати області для покращення.
Постійний Моніторинг Продуктивності
Оптимізація продуктивності – це постійний процес. Регулярний моніторинг продуктивності вашого вебсайту та адаптація стратегій до нових технологій та методів є ключовим для забезпечення оптимального користувацького досвіду.
Висновок
Оптимізація продуктивності є важливою складовою веб-розробки, яка безпосередньо впливає на користувацький досвід, SEO та загальний успіх. Шляхом впровадження ефективних стратегій тестування та відлагодження, а також постійного моніторингу продуктивності вашого вебсайту, ви можете забезпечити, що ваш сайт залишиться швидким, ефективним та випередить конкуренцію. Пам’ятайте, що швидкий вебсайт – це не лише операційна необхідність; це конкурентна перевага, яка може відрізнити вас в цифровому ландшафті.